## Step 4: Point the green billing worker at the ledger DB

Welcome aboard! Once the green Tollgate worker pool is spun up, don't cut traffic over yet — first confirm it can actually reach the ledger database. Blue keeps processing invoices the whole time, so there's no rush. Run the smoke check from the green host, which reads its target from the value below. For that check, use the following connection string.

replica DSN, kajep-yahag: mssql://praok_svc:iF@db-8d68.plorvaio.local:5432/eliion

## Idempotency Keys for Payment Retries (Lumopay)

Every retry of a charge request must reuse the original idempotency key; generating a new key on retry can produce duplicate charges. Keys are scoped per merchant and expire after 48 hours. Reviewers should verify keys are derived server-side, never from client input. The full key-generation specification and threat model are maintained on the internal page.

dashboard of kaguf-tawip = https://vault.merlaqsys.test/issue

Onboarding note for the Ledgerpane admin table: bulk edits are applied through the batcher service, not directly against the database. Select rows, choose an action, and the batcher stages changes in a pending set you can review before commit. Edits over 500 rows require a second approver — this is enforced server-side, so don't try to chunk around it. To run the batcher locally you need the staging write credential, which goes in your .env as the next line.

secret setting of bahip-kagag: RELAY_SECRET3=c83